Henden Statistics Back to top
- Population (2000): 125
- Land Area (2000): 93.135 square kilometers
- Water Area (2000): 0.000 square kilometers
Houses (2000): 49
Henden Population - Urban/Rural
Urban/Rural |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Urban | 0 | 0.00% |
Rural, Farm | 78 | 59.09% |
Rural, Non-farm | 54 | 40.91% |
